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[GitHub Request] Add @0ctopus13prime as the maintainer for the k-NN repo #257

Closed
navneet1v opened this issue Jan 3, 2025 · 5 comments
Closed
Assignees

Comments

@navneet1v
Copy link

navneet1v commented Jan 3, 2025

What is the type of request?

User Permission

Details of the request

We would like to add @0ctopus13prime to MAINTAINERS.md and .github/CODEOWNERS of opensearch plugin repos [k-NN] so that he can approve PRs and merge code into the main branch.

Additional information to support your request

We have received upvotes (including myself) from existing maintainers of opensearch k-nn to add @0ctopus13prime as the maintainers of this repo.

Doo Yong Kim has been working in k-NN plugin for over 3 months has contributed on some of the core pieces of k-NN plugin and JNI layer. Features includes introducing loading layer for native engines to make k-NN plugin directory agnostic and making k-NN plugin compatible with remote directories for both read and write. He is already working on the Partial graph loading feature for native engines which allow k-NN plugin to run on the memory constraint environment. One of his core expertise includes his experience in C/C++ code and him being a maintainer will allow us to review and optimize the JNI layer further(this can already be seen in his PRs). He has read the contribution guidelines and maintainer responsibilities.

Below are some of his PRs:
opensearch-project/k-NN#2241
opensearch-project/k-NN#2220
opensearch-project/k-NN#2185
opensearch-project/k-NN#2139
opensearch-project/k-NN#1982
opensearch-project/k-NN#1978
opensearch-project/k-NN#1946
opensearch-project/k-NN#1936

Along with the features he has been a review of different pull requests. Some of them are added below.
opensearch-project/k-NN#2320
opensearch-project/k-NN#2308
opensearch-project/k-NN#2345

Tagging maintainers who have already upvoted: @heemin32 @navneet1v @VijayanB @vamshin @naveentatikonda @martin-gaievski @ryanbogan

When does this request need to be completed?

This is not an urgent request. 2-3 business days is fine.

Notes

Track the progress of your request here: https://github.com/orgs/opensearch-project/projects/208/views/33.
Member of @opensearch-project/admin will take a look at the request soon.
Thanks!

@peterzhuamazon
Copy link
Member

Pending #258 to be completed before proceeding on this.

@peterzhuamazon peterzhuamazon moved this from 🆕 New to ⌛ On Hold in Engineering Effectiveness Board Jan 3, 2025
@rishabh6788 rishabh6788 moved this from ⌛ On Hold to 🏗 In progress in Engineering Effectiveness Board Jan 6, 2025
@rishabh6788 rishabh6788 moved this from 🏗 In progress to 📋 Escalation in Engineering Effectiveness Board Jan 6, 2025
@peterzhuamazon peterzhuamazon moved this from 📋 Escalation to 🏗 In progress in Engineering Effectiveness Board Jan 6, 2025
@rishabh6788
Copy link

@0ctopus13prime would have received an invite to join the opensearch-project org. Please accept and confirm here.

@0ctopus13prime
Copy link

@rishabh6788 yes, I received the invitation

@rishabh6788
Copy link

@0ctopus13prime has been added as maintainer for k-NN repo.

@github-project-automation github-project-automation bot moved this from 🏗 In progress to ✅ Done in Engineering Effectiveness Board Jan 7, 2025
@peterzhuamazon
Copy link
Member

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
Status: ✅ Done
Development

No branches or pull requests

4 participants